2. Deltek
Best for: Government contracting and compliance-heavy industries
Deltek specializes in ERP solutions for project focused industries, particularly government contractors and architectural firms. It offers powerful tools for cost control, contract management, and compliance reporting, which makes it ideal for firms working in regulated environments.
Their project ERP system integrates accounting, time tracking, and resource planning while helping firms to align with industry standards such as DCAA or ISO. If your projects are requiring tight documentation and reporting, Deltek is a strong contender!
3. BigTime
Best for: Professional services time tracking and billing
A cloud based platform that is designed for consulting, architecture and IT services firms, BigTime shines in its ability to simplify time tracking, invoicing and expense management. This makes it much easier for firms to improve their cash flow and reduce billing errors.
Its intuitive interface makes it easy for team members to submit hours and expenses while automated workflows streamline approvals and payroll. For growing professional services teams that need reliable and easy to use solutions, BigTime is an excellent option.
4. Kantata
Best for: Managing complex services lifecycles
Formerly Mavenlink, Kantata helps service based businesses manage the full life cycle of their client projects. From scoping and resourcing to project execution and delivery. It offers end to end visibility and control.
Kantata stands out for its focus on collaboration as well as resource forecasting. They are able to offer real time dashboards and analytics that help managers anticipate bottlenecks and adjust in real time. With native integrations to platforms like Salesforce and Slack, Kantata fits seamlessly into existing workflows.
5. Wrike
Best for: Cross-functional project collaboration
Wrike is a collaborative work management platform that bends task management with real time reporting. While it's suitable for a wide range of industries, it's especially effective for those in professional services that look to bridge gaps between teams, clients, and project timelines with customizable, easy workflows, Gantt charts, and time tracking features.
Wrike enables organisations to gain real time visibility into their project status and they can do this while reducing admin overheads. It offers a user-friendly UI and powerful integrations with tools like Microsoft Teams and Adobe Creative Cloud. This makes it ideal for agencies and consulting firms.
6. Scoro
Best for: All-in-one business management for consultancies
Scoro combines project management with CRM, billing, and business analytics. It's particularly useful for consultancies and creative agencies that want one platform to manage the entire client lifecycle, from prospecting to delivery and invoicing.
Scoro helps to prevent scope creep and missed revenue. It does so by tightly aligning project milestones with billing and financial planning. For teams that want real time data across sales, project delivery and finance, Scoro provides the integrated solution without requiring the multiple tools.
7. Workamajig
Best for: Creative and marketing teams with client work
Workamajig is designed specifically for those in-house creative teams and marketing agencies that need something more. It merges project management with budgeting, resource planning and client billing. What makes it unique is its client collaboration portal, which helps to reduce miscommunication and feedback loops during creative projects.Its resource management tools allow teams to allocate workloads based on availability and skill sets, which is ideal for managing multiple campaigns and client deliverables simultaneously.
Workamajig offers both cloud and on premise solutions, which makes it a flexible option depending on your organization's preferences.
